About Cambridge Museum of Technology

Built in 1894, this is a rare venue with heritage that has been lovingly restored. Preserved is its original machinery showcasing 19th-century engineering and technology.

The Pumping Station which is a scheduled Ancient Monument is situated beside the River Cam. A stunning backdrop to your event with the iconic chimney which can be lit up. The site also has green spaces for picnics and a fun, relaxed atmosphere.

Our buildings are licensed until 11pm and we have three excellent local suppliers on site Kerb Kollective, Calverley Brewery and Scotts.

We’re committed to being eco friendly and our energy is provided by Solar Panels. For our steam engines we use Eco Logs to minimise our environmental impact.
